Generated
Admin
GET
/
admin.oneSuccessful response
POST
/
admin.createUserInvitationAdmin create User Invitation
Authorization
AuthorizationRequiredBearer <token>
In: header
Request Body
application/jsonRequiredemailRequiredstring
Format:
"email"Successful response
POST
/
admin.removeUserAdmin remove User
Authorization
AuthorizationRequiredBearer <token>
In: header
Request Body
application/jsonRequiredauthIdRequiredstring
Minimum length:
1Successful response
GET
/
admin.getUserByTokenAdmin get User By Token
Authorization
AuthorizationRequiredBearer <token>
In: header
Query Parameters
tokenRequiredstring
Minimum length:
1Successful response
POST
/
admin.assignPermissionsAdmin assign Permissions
Authorization
AuthorizationRequiredBearer <token>
In: header
Request Body
application/jsonRequireduserIdRequiredstring
Minimum length:
1canCreateProjectsRequiredboolean
canCreateServicesRequiredboolean
canDeleteProjectsRequiredboolean
canDeleteServicesRequiredboolean
accesedProjectsRequiredarray<string>
accesedServicesRequiredarray<string>
canAccessToTraefikFilesRequiredboolean
canAccessToDockerRequiredboolean
canAccessToAPIRequiredboolean
canAccessToSSHKeysRequiredboolean
canAccessToGitProvidersRequiredboolean
Successful response